Shadowsocks 日志位置详解

介绍

在使用Shadowsocks进行科学上网的过程中,很多用户可能会对其日志产生兴趣,特别是想了解日志的位置、如何查看日志以及如何使用这些日志信息进行故障排查。本文将详细探讨Shadowsocks的日志位置。

什么是Shadowsocks日志?

Shadowsocks日志是指该代理工具在运行过程中生成的记录,主要包括连接状态、错误信息、用户活动等。通过分析这些日志,用户可以了解到:

  • 代理的工作状态
  • 连接是否成功
  • 错误的原因

Shadowsocks日志的存储位置

Shadowsocks日志的存储位置与操作系统和安装方式密切相关。一般来说,Shadowsocks的日志位置可以通过以下几种方式找到:

1. Windows系统

  • 默认情况下,Shadowsocks在Windows系统中将日志保存在安装目录下的logs文件夹内。例如:
    • C:\Program Files\Shadowsocks\logs

2. macOS系统

  • 在macOS中,日志通常位于以下路径:
    • /usr/local/shadowsocks/logs
  • 或者在用户的主目录下的特定文件夹:
    • ~/Library/Logs/Shadowsocks

3. Linux系统

  • 对于Linux用户,日志的默认位置通常是在:
    • /var/log/shadowsocks.log
  • 但如果用户自定义了配置文件,日志位置可能会根据配置而有所不同。

4. Android与iOS

  • 在移动端应用中,日志通常不直接暴露给用户,但有些第三方工具可以帮助查看相关日志信息。

如何查看Shadowsocks日志?

查看Shadowsocks的日志非常简单,用户可以通过以下几种方法实现:

1. 使用文本编辑器

  • 用户可以使用文本编辑器(如Notepad、TextEdit等)打开日志文件,直接查看其中的内容。此方法适用于所有操作系统。

2. 命令行工具

  • 在Linux和macOS系统中,可以通过命令行工具使用cattail命令查看日志。例如:
    • tail -f /var/log/shadowsocks.log

3. 监控工具

  • 有些监控工具可以集成Shadowsocks日志,方便用户进行实时监控和管理。

如何利用Shadowsocks日志进行故障排查

Shadowsocks日志对于故障排查至关重要,用户可以通过分析日志中的信息来找出问题所在。

常见错误及解决方案

  • 连接超时:通常是网络问题,可以检查网络状态或重启路由器。
  • 认证失败:可能是由于密码错误,建议核对服务器的密码设置。
  • 无法连接服务器:检查服务器地址是否正确,或服务器是否在线。

利用日志进行优化

  • 根据日志中的流量数据,用户可以合理调整带宽和服务器配置,以提高连接效率。

FAQ

1. Shadowsocks日志可以记录哪些信息?

Shadowsocks日志可以记录连接成功与否、数据传输量、错误信息以及客户端和服务器之间的交互状态。

2. 如何清除Shadowsocks日志?

用户可以手动删除日志文件,也可以在Shadowsocks的设置中找到日志管理功能,选择清除或禁用日志记录。

3. Shadowsocks日志会影响性能吗?

通常来说,Shadowsocks的日志记录对性能影响微乎其微,但大量日志文件可能会占用存储空间,因此适时清理是必要的。

4. 如何更改Shadowsocks日志的位置?

用户可以通过编辑Shadowsocks的配置文件,修改日志的存储路径。但需确保所指定路径具有写入权限。

结论

通过本文的详细介绍,相信读者对Shadowsocks的日志位置有了更加清晰的认识。有效利用这些日志信息,能够帮助用户更好地管理和优化自己的代理服务。如果您在使用过程中遇到其他问题,请参考官方文档或社区支持。

正文完